MLT 255
Clinical Microbiology
Kirkwood Community College ·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
Examines the essential principles of bacteriology relative to human disease with emphasis on knowledge regarding the pathogenicity of the microorganisms presented. Emphasizes competence in general procedures such as cultivation, isolation, and identification of organisms. Discusses evaluation/interpretation of laboratory data. Arts & Sciences Elective Code: B
